“Because of the dramatic weight loss following bariatric surgery, it is generally recommended that women avoid pregnancy until after the first 12-18 months or until their weight stabilizes,” according to a Bariatric Times article by Jane Alston and Giselle Hamad, MD, FACS, “Management and Outcomes of Pregnancy following Bariatric Surgery.” Unexpected pregnancies are a “unique [...]
